Australian Open 2025: Women’s Singles Results, Scores, and Schedule
The women’s singles kicked off with a bang! Defending champion Aryna Sabalenka started her title defense strong by defeating Sloane Stephens in straight sets. As one of the favorites this year, Sabalenka is aiming for her third consecutive title. Here’s a quick look at the Day 1 results for the women’s singles:
- Aryna Sabalenka vs. Sloane Stephens: 6-4, 6-3
- Iga Swiatek vs. Katerina Siniakova: 6-3, 6-4

Men’s Singles (Round 1 – Day 1 | Round 1 – Day 2)
On Day 2 for the men’s singles, reigning champion Jannik Sinner showcased his skills by beating Nicolas Jarry in a hard-fought match. Sinner won with scores of 7-6(2), 7-6(5), 6-1, proving he is a strong contender to retain his title. Another star attraction was Novak Djokovic, who faced Nishesh Basavareddy and won in four sets, 4-6, 6-3, 6-4, 6-2.
